What Is A Commercial Network Cable?
Ontario businesses can benefit significantly from structured cabling. This is the use of cables and wires inside an office or building to enable the transmission of signals from one device to another. The main components of a structured cabling system include cables (obviously) as well as wall plates, patch panels, and outlets.

What Cables Are Used For Networking?
There are many types of network cable. We can divide them into two main categories: unshielded twisted pair, or UTP, and fiber-optic cable. Most networks use UTP because it’s more affordable than fiber-optic, easier to work with, and can carry data fast enough for most purposes. But there are a few drawbacks with UTP.
Shielded twisted pair, or STP, is a variation on UTP that uses a metallic shield to protect the wires inside from interference from external sources. STP offers an advantage over UTP because it reduces electromagnetic emissions. STP is beneficial in environments where electronic interference from other devices could cause problems. The disadvantage of STP is that it’s harder to install and more expensive than UTP.
Fiber-optic cable has the advantage of offering more bandwidth and requiring less signal amplification than UTP or STP. Fiber-optic cable consists of threads of glass or plastic with different numbers of strands. The more strands there are in the thread, the more accurate and faster the signal is. Options for network cable types include ethernet cable, Cat5e, Cat6, Cat6a, Cat7, and as mentioned, fiber-optic.
Commercial Network Cable Installation Pricing
We can already see one factor that affects network cable installation pricing: fiber-optic costs more than UTP. Length is another consideration. The more cable you need, the more the job will cost. Another factor is infrastructure. Some buildings are easier to thread cable through than others.
